Review: On Sunday, 27 April 2014, I contacted Tim's Carpet Cleaning to inquire about deep scrubbing services for my home. My home is less than 5 years old, and I am the only owner, so there haven't been many concerns about my carpet over the years. I recently got a young puppy, and have been having problems with urine accidents. This was my main concern, and motivation for seeking carpet cleaning services, but as any other house...I had minor surface stains and traffic areas as well. [redacted] (the owner) is whom I spoke to when I called. I told him my concerns, and he said that he provides the services to help. We started speaking about scheduling an appointment, and came to the solution of doing it on the same exact day that the phone call was initiated (Sunday, 27 April 2014). The appointment was for later that evening. We agreed for him to come out at 1830hrs. [redacted] did not arrive to my home until 1915hrs. He also arrived with his son, whom I was unaware would be coming. Upon letting them into my home, his son immediately went to sit on my sofa. This I found to be really unprofessional, but [redacted] did not say a word. We started to go through the house for a pre-inspection of the carpet before he started cleaning. He brought in his black light to spot all urine stains. While going through, I also pointed out the surface stains that I wanted him to pay attention to. He said that with the deep scrubbing, it would get not only those stains out but also the urine stains as well that I couldn't see with the naked eye. He quoted me $250.00 for the entire house to specially treat the urine stains, but the advertisement and also what we spoke about before he came to my house was for $100.00 for unlimited square feet, including stairs. I asked him why the price went up, and he stated that it was because he would have to treat and deodorize the stains. We agreed that only the bottom level would be done (since that was the worst) and stay within the previously talked about price range. This is only after I told him that I wanted to think about it, and just call him back with an appointment if I decided to go with his services and quote. He kept insisting on him making me a good deal, and that he was here to "make me feel good". I felt a bit uneasy with the comment that he made because of the manner in which he made it, but dismissed it because I didn't think someone would be so unprofessional.

After agreeing to his deal to only do the bottom half, [redacted] and his son went to go get the equipment, and [redacted] started cleaning, while his son sat on my sofa again watching T.V. As soon as he plugged in his machine, he tripped my circuit and made the electricity go out on the bottom half of the house. When he went to reset the fuse box, some of the outlets came back on while others in my kitchen remained off. When I noticed this, I tried telling him that they were still not working. He said that the one he was using was working, and that the kitchen outlets weren't something that he did. I was stunned by his comment, but just tried to reset them myself. After hitting the reset/test button many times, the outlets came on, but the light was still out. So I made note of it, so that I can call the electrical company out to make sure he didn't damage anything.

As [redacted] was cleaning, I began to ask him about the type of solution, and the process of his cleaning, so that I can better understand what was going on with my carpet. [redacted] hesitated to answer my questions, and when he did he seemed very irritable. I asked [redacted] what was the name of his insurance company, just so I can know more about the company I was dealing with since I did not have the time to research before his arrival, and he did not have a website, but he did say he was bonded and insured. When I asked [redacted] this question, he act as if he didn't hear me, I asked again, and he he stated "you know that company in Fredericksburg"? I asked with confusion again the name of the company, he then stated "[redacted]". As he continued to clean, I noticed that even the surface stains on the carpet that I pointed out to him were not coming up. I would ask him if that was going to come out, and if he was going to go back over it to assure the stains were indeed being removed. He said that he would and that I needed to let him finish. I began to question his work ethic, and asked him to stop cleaning as I was not seeing any results, and my carpet was looking the same as if he never touched it. I also asked if he was going to extract the water that he was putting into my carpet, and he said no that it would dry within an hour and a half. I then became extremely concerned about how he was trying to clean the carpet and continued to ask him to stop. He said I needed to just let him finish so I can see the results, and that he would go back over the problem areas. I allowed him to continue, as I was starting to get uncomfortable with going back and forth with him. He picked up his equipment other than a small machine he did the stairs with, and came back upstairs to tell me the job was done. I then told him that I wasn't happy with the results, and he never went back over the areas that I spoke on. Every time I tried to voice my concern about the in particular areas, he would cut me off very rudely and tell me to show him where so he can fix them, but in a very irritable defensive manner. As I would try to show him, and continue to ask or say something, he would turn on his machine to drown me out and say things like "there are you happy, the stain is out, where is another one". I told him that he was starting to get extremely rude and aggressive, and that I did not appreciate the way he was speaking to me or handling the situation. He then got aggressive with his verbiage, and started to get really insulting. All of this happening while he was in my face and my daughter in the living room. I then started to ask him to leave my home because his composure wasn't being maintained, and he needed to first try listening to my concerns before he got so defensive. His son got up from the sofa and came to the kitchen area where we were standing and came right beside me. This made me feel very threaten as both [redacted] and his son had surrounded me. So I continued to tell him to leave my house. He told me to just pay him his money and then he'll leave. I said that I wasn't paying for services he did not render. He continued with his disrespect, and starting cursing at me calling me all kinds of names. All this happening in front of my seven year old daughter. I asked if there was anyone else I can speak to about how he was conducting customer service. He said that he was the owner and he has been in business for 32 years. So I told him that I would pay him half ($50.00) just to get him out of my home. He got loud and angry and said for me to give him his money so he can go. He asked if I was paying with my credit card or check. I told him neither, and that I would rather pay with cash because I did not trust him with my card information. I told him that I would go to the [redacted] to get cash, but he needed to leave and wait for me in the front of my home. He got upset, and continued to call me out of my name and yelled the whole way out slamming my door behind him.

I immediately grabbed my daughter, secured my house and left to head to the [redacted]. After what I experience, I refused to go back to my home to make any payments by myself, and called my friend to assist and accompany me. While on the phone with her, [redacted] called in on the other line, and continued to yell and say that he will be waiting for me upon my return to get all his money. He continued to be insulting and started threatening to just take me to court for the full $100.00. I told him at this point the threats and name calling were enough, and that he needed to leave because I was not returning at that point with fear that he may get out of control. I told him that I would be calling the cops if he continued at the rate he was going. The more I talked the more upset and crazy he got. After explaining everything to my friend, she insisted that we went to the police station, as I was not going back to my house knowing he was sitting outside of it. I went to get my friend to head to the police station, and he started sending me text messages about taking me to court and being insulting. I did not respond. After telling the situation to the police, they insisted on them escorting me back to my home to assure he was no longer there, and if so to issue a no trespassing notification. He was no longer there when we returned and the police made sure he wasn't in the neighborhood. I immediately took pictures of my carpet. I contacted the insurance company name that he gave me the very next morning, and the company informed me that not only does he not have business commercial general liability insurance, but also that they did not carry that type of insurance. It was his automotive insurance that he use to have with them, but that had also expired in December 2013. I then realized why he became so defensive so quickly, and that I got myself involved with a scam artist.Desired Settlement: The owner has contacted me in a very disrespectful manner and threatening me with a lawsuit to pay for services he did not render. I would not only like for this harassment to stop, but also for others to be aware of this scam. He is running a bogus business, and does not know how to properly conduct himself.

Review: Tim's Carpet Cleaning did a horrible job cleaning my carpets. He shampooed my carpet in less than 45 minutes than left. Out of all the times I have got my carpet cleaned, my carpet was shampooed then vacuumed up. While he was cleaning my home he pulls up in a vehicle with almost no carpet cleaning tools inside, I almost didn't open the door. Then he tries to tell me it will be an extra 80 dollars if I wanted any stain to get out the carpet, ANY stain. I preceded to let him performed the extra cleaning until I realized he only had a shampooer. His helper cleaned the stairs and only cleaned the top steps not the stairs. I talked to him about the stairs and he said that is how it suppose to be cleaned. Cleaning 2 or 3 steps on the stairs is not cleaning all the carpet on the stairs. It took almost 8 hours to dry, now I hope I don't have any mold problems.Desired Settlement: I would like my refund back. I feel that I paid someone to put buffer lines in my carpet when I could of did that with my vacuum. I paid to get the carpet cleaned and I understand not every stain will come out but it shouldn't look worse than before.
